A Great Printer

5

First I must say that I was strictly a Canon Products girl. I was sold on this printer when an Epson Rep displayed it's fantastic qualities. I owned one HP Wide Format, one Canon Photo and the Epson Sytlus R260. The R260 is worth every penny I paid for it and more. I do genealogy and used my printer almost daily. Yes, it uses a lot of ink, but that is primarily because it's a PHOTO printer which prints great quality photos. That is why it has to constantly keeping cleaning the print heads, thus, consuming a lot of ink. I primarily use it to print labels on family geanealogy disks. The ink is guaranteed to last for 100 years and is waterproof. I put it to the test by soaking two separate photos overnight in a glass of water; on printed on my Epson R260 and one with my canon (I won't say which one). The photo printed with the canon ink was ruined. The photo printed with the Epson (expensive Claria) ink was untouch because the ink is absolutely smudge proof and water-resistant. No problems with at all in the 4-5 years I've owned it. Thanks Epson for a great product.

Can't get worse than this

1

Worst printer I have ever seen. An attempt to use it generally necessitates a head cleaning operation before it can print copy that is readable. That means you need to plan to spend about ten minutes working with the machine before you can actually print a single piece of paper. The ink cartridges empty quickly and clog frequently. Printing is not possible if one color cartridge is out, even if that color isn't needed. There is nothing redeemable about this machine. I am literally throwing it out and purchasing something else.
